    Ep 185 - Wednesday Wisdom - Put It In Your Diary/Schedule

    Play Episode Listen Later Mar 31, 2026 10:33


    Win a $350 True Protein Gift Pack - Sign Up HereSign up for the free course/library of 22 drills to help you get better at golf hereWednesday Wisdom: If It's Not in Your Diary… It's Not Getting Done Everyone says they want to get better. They want to practice more.They want to get fitter.They want to lower their handicap. But here's the truth… If it's not scheduled, it's just a wish. The players who improve the most aren't always the most talented — they're the ones who are organised. They treat their improvement like an appointment, not an option. Think about it this way: You don't “try” to show up to a lesson… you book it.You don't “hope” to go to work… you schedule it. So why is your improvement treated any differently? If you're serious about getting better, start putting it in your diary:30 minutes of putting practice1 hour on the range working on a specific skillGym sessionsEven 10 minutes at home working on your setupLock it in. Just like a meeting. Just like a lesson. Because once it's in your diary, something changes:You're more accountableYou're less likely to skip itYou start building consistencyAnd consistency is what actually moves the needle. Most golfers don't fail because they don't know what to do…They fail because they don't consistently do it. So here's a simple challenge: Open your diary right now and book your next 3 practice sessions. Not “sometime this week.”Specific day. Specific time. Treat your game like it matters — and it will start to show.Win a $350 True Protein Gift Pack - Sign Up HereSign up for the free course/library of 22 drills to help you get better at golf hereWe thank Titleist - The number 1 brand in golf for their continued support of the YGP Podcast!

    Ep 175 - Wednesday (midweek) Wisdom - The 32-Metre Gap That Wasn't a Swing Fault

    Play Episode Listen Later Feb 19, 2026 11:17


    This week I want to share a really interesting lesson from a coaching session that opened up a bigger conversation about performance. I had a client who has been improving really nicely. His swing is trending in the right direction, contact is better, and overall ball flight has improved. But there was still one big frustration… inconsistency with his irons. So we put him on the launch monitor. With his 7 iron, his carry distance was ranging anywhere from 109 metres to 141 metres. That's a 32-metre gap with the same club. For any golfer, that's nearly the difference between being on the green or in a bunker over the back. Now here's where it gets interesting. I grabbed a different 7 iron — something I felt was better suited to his speed and delivery. Same player. Same swing. Same session. Suddenly his carries were between 138 metres and 143 metres. Tight window. Predictable. Repeatable. Nothing magical happened to his technique in those 10 minutes. The difference? Equipment. In this episode we talk about:Why inconsistency isn't always a swing issueHow launch monitor data can expose hidden problemsThe role shafts, loft, and head design play in distance controlWhy guessing your yardages can cost you shots every roundSometimes we beat ourselves up thinking our swing is broken… when in reality, the tools we're using might be working against us. If you've ever felt like you “flush one” and it comes up 20 metres short — this episode is for you.We thank Titleist - The number 1 brand in golf for their continued support of the YGP Podcast!

    Ep 171 - Wednesday Wisdom - Hand Brake or Foot Brake?

    Play Episode Listen Later Feb 3, 2026 9:06


    Ever jumped into a new car and suddenly the hand brake is gone… replaced by a foot brake? You know how to drive. You know how to stop. But for a while, everything feels awkward, slow, and uncomfortable. In this episode, we talk about why learning new habits and skills always feels worse before it feels better — whether that's changing something in your golf swing, your practice habits, or even something as simple as adapting to a new car. We break down how the brain actually learns new patterns, why performance often dips during change, and why so many people quit right before the breakthrough happens. If you've ever felt frustrated trying to change a habit — in golf or in life — this episode will help you understand why that feeling is normal and how to push through it the smart way.

    Ep 159 - Wednesday Wisdom - Nail Your 50 - 100m Wedges

    Play Episode Listen Later Dec 2, 2025 9:01


    In this week's Wednesday Wisdom, Brent tackles the most confusing scoring zone in golf — the dreaded 50–100 metre “No Man's Land.” Most golfers guess at these shots… and that guesswork is costing them strokes every round. Brent breaks down a simple, tour-proven system built around your four wedges — pitching wedge, gap wedge, sand wedge, and lob wedge. You'll learn how to develop three stock swings for each club — half, 75%, and full — and how to record your carry distances so you never stand over a wedge feeling unsure again. By the end of this episode, you'll know how to build your own Wedge Matrix, a personalised chart that shows exactly how far each wedge flies with each swing length. This is one of the fastest ways to lower scores and take the mystery out of your distance wedges. If you've ever stood in “No Man's Land” and hoped for the best… this episode will give you a plan you can trust.JOIN THE TITLEIST GIVEAWAY HEREWe thank Titleist - The number 1 brand in golf for their continued support of the YGP Podcast!

    Ep 155 - Wednesday Wisdom - When Should You Upgrade Your Clubs?

    Play Episode Listen Later Nov 19, 2025 13:51


    Wednesday Wisdom — When to Upgrade Your Clubs.Today I talked about the importance of upgrading your equipment at the right time. As your swing changes, your clubs need to match who you are now, not who you were years ago. When to Consider UpgradingDistances or ball flight have changedShaft no longer suits your speedSame miss keeps showing upWedges have worn groovesGeneral TimelinesDriver/Woods: every 2–3 yearsIrons: every 5 yearsWedges: every 12–18 monthsPutter: If it aint broke - don't fix it!Bottom line: The right equipment removes compensations and helps you play your best.JOIN THE TITLEIST GIVEAWAY HEREWe thank Titleist - The number 1 brand in golf for their continued support of the YGP Podcast!
